A New Era in Surgery: The Rise of Minimally Invasive Approaches

The modern operating room is a far cry from the large incisions and extended hospital stays that characterized surgery a century ago.

Surgeons today increasingly rely on techniques that minimize tissue disruption and preserve the natural anatomy of the body.

At the heart of these innovations are micro-invasive and muscle-sparing procedures.

Micro-invasive surgery refers to techniques that use small incisions, specialized instruments, and high-definition imaging to access and treat internal conditions with minimal disruption to surrounding tissues.

Alternatively, muscle-sparing surgery focuses on preserving the integrity of muscle tissue during procedures that traditionally required more extensive muscle dissection.

Both methods click site are part of a broader movement toward reducing patient morbidity, pain, and recovery time.

Historical Context: Moving from Open Surgery to Tissue Conservation

Surgical techniques were traditionally governed by necessity and the limits of available technology.

Before the advent of modern imaging and instrumentation, surgeons often had no alternative but to perform large, open incisions to gain adequate visibility and access to the operative site.

While lifesaving, these methods often left patients with significant postoperative pain, lengthy recoveries, and the risk of complications such as infections or chronic muscle weakness.

The change started with the emergence of laparoscopic surgery in the late 20th century—a minimally disruptive technique that provided internal visualization using a diminutive camera inserted through minor incisions.

Technological improvements led surgeons to understand that maintaining muscle integrity during interventions could offer enhanced advantages.

Muscle-sparing techniques, initially developed in orthopedics and cardiovascular surgery, soon found applications in abdominal, gynecological, and oncological procedures, among others.

Dr. Eleanor Matthews , a pioneer in minimally invasive approaches at a respected teaching hospital, affirms: “We realized that every incision we made, every muscle we cut, had a lasting impact on our patients. The drive to improve quality of life post-surgery has pushed us to continually refine our methods.”

This evolution toward minimally disruptive methods not only represents a technical achievement but also a profound change in the philosophy of surgical care.

The Rationale Behind the Procedures

Micro-Invasive Surgery: Precision Through Technology
At the core of micro-invasive surgery is the principle of precision.

Surgeons use an array of high-tech tools—from endoscopes and robotic-assisted devices to specialized microscopes—to navigate the human body through minuscule openings.

These tools yield improved magnification and light, which facilitates exact localization and treatment of the designated area without causing significant tissue harm.

One of the most significant innovations has been the integration of robotic-assisted surgical systems.

These advanced systems empower surgeons with unmatched steadiness and precision, effectively nullifying hand tremors and converting minor motions into meticulously controlled actions.

In procedures such as prostatectomies and cardiac surgeries, this precision translates directly into improved patient outcomes.

Cardiothoracic Surgery: Minimizing Cardiac Trauma

Cardiothoracic procedures have markedly profited from minimally invasive techniques.

Procedures like valve repair and CABG have long necessitated large incisions and comprehensive dissection of muscle tissue.

Today, surgeons increasingly employ minimally invasive techniques that use small incisions and specialized instruments to access the heart and surrounding structures.

The adoption of robotic-assisted systems in cardiothoracic surgery has further refined these procedures.

Frequently, the robotic system affords the requisite precision to execute subtle maneuvers on the moving heart, minimizing complications and hastening recovery.

A comparative study published in the Annals of Thoracic Surgery found that patients undergoing minimally invasive valve repairs had lower rates of postoperative atrial fibrillation and shorter hospital stays compared to those who underwent conventional surgery.

General and Gynecologic Surgery: Enhancing Patient Outcomes.

In the realm of general and gynecologic surgery, micro-invasive techniques have transformed procedures such as gallbladder removals, hernia repairs, and hysterectomies.

The shift toward smaller incisions and muscle preservation not only reduces the visible scarring but also minimizes postoperative discomfort and the potential for complications.

For instance, laparoscopic cholecystectomy—removal of the gallbladder through small incisions—has become the standard of care in many parts of the world.

Patients benefit from shorter recovery times and the ability to resume normal activities almost immediately after the procedure.

In gynecology, muscle-sparing techniques have been instrumental in improving outcomes for women undergoing complex procedures such as myomectomies or pelvic floor repairs.

A review of clinical outcomes in a leading medical journal noted that minimally invasive gynecologic surgeries result in lower rates of infection and blood loss, along with improved cosmetic outcomes.

These enhancements not only increase patient satisfaction but also foster improved overall health results.

Weighing the Benefits and Challenges.

Advantages Extending Past the Surgical Suite.

The advantages of micro-invasive and muscle-sparing surgical methods extend well beyond the technical aspects of surgery.

Patients experience real, life-altering benefits.

Reduced pain, minimized scarring, and faster recovery times translate directly into an improved quality of life.

In many cases, patients can return to work and resume daily activities within days rather than weeks, a critical factor in an increasingly fast-paced world.

From a comprehensive healthcare viewpoint, such techniques reduce overall hospital costs by minimizing both the length of stay and the postoperative care needed.

Additionally, fewer complications mean fewer readmissions, which is a significant consideration for healthcare providers and insurers alike.

The psychological benefits should not be underestimated.

Knowing that the surgery involves minimal bodily disruption provides significant reassurance and cuts down preoperative anxiety.

This aspect is particularly important for patients facing major surgeries, as a calmer, more positive outlook can contribute to better overall outcomes.

Limitations and Hurdles: A Realistic Outlook.

Despite the numerous advantages, micro-invasive and muscle-sparing techniques are not without challenges.

One significant limitation is the steep learning curve associated with these advanced methods.

Practitioners are required to engage in intensive training and accrue considerable experience before executing these procedures at par with conventional surgery.

The initial investment in advanced technology and training can be substantial, making it less accessible in resource-limited settings.

Moreover, not all patients are ideal candidates for these approaches.

In situations with extensive disease or challenging anatomy, traditional open surgery may still provide the safest and most effective treatment.

Surgeons are required to carefully analyze every situation, comparing the benefits of minimally invasive approaches with the patient’s individual circumstances.

Also, technological constraints are a contributing factor.

Even with state-of-the-art equipment, there can be instances where the operative field is limited, or unexpected complications arise, necessitating conversion to an open procedure.

These scenarios, while relatively rare, highlight the importance of having a versatile surgical team that is prepared to adapt to changing circumstances.

The Future of Surgery: Trends and Innovations.

Adopting AI-Enabled and Robotic Approaches.

While current micro-invasive and muscle-sparing techniques have already made a profound impact, the future promises even more dramatic changes.

The integration of artificial intelligence (AI) and machine learning into surgical systems is poised to further enhance precision and efficiency.

Such technologies are capable of processing enormous volumes of data in real time, thereby providing surgeons with predictive insights to enhance decision-making in complex procedures.

For example, AI-powered imaging systems are being developed to automatically highlight critical anatomical structures, reducing the risk of inadvertent injury.

Moreover, the evolution of robotic platforms includes next-generation systems that provide finer control and augmented haptic feedback, enabling surgeons to perceive tissue textures—a capability not available in standard laparoscopic instruments.

Pushing the Limits of Minimally Invasive Surgery.

Research and development in tissue engineering and regenerative medicine are anticipated to intersect with forward-thinking surgical innovations.

Scientists are exploring ways to not only minimize tissue damage but also promote faster, more natural healing.

This includes the use of bioengineered scaffolds that can support tissue regeneration and reduce scar formation after surgery.

Moreover, as imaging and sensor technology continue to improve, surgeons may be able to perform procedures that are even less invasive than those currently available.

Innovations such as nanorobots and miniature, implantable devices could one day allow for targeted therapy and diagnostics at a cellular level, ushering in a new era of truly personalized medicine.
